Tea Tree Oil Face Spots: Do They Really Work?

Many users are curious if applying tea tree oil directly to face imperfections can truly clear them up . While tea tree oil possesses recognized antimicrobial properties that can fight problematic bacteria, using it without dilution is generally discouraged . It's a potent ingredient and can lead to irritation or even skin damage if applied undiluted. Therefore, while promising , relying solely on tea tree oil face spots for complete elimination might not be the essential oils for skin care best approach . A patch test is always recommended before widespread application .

Skincare Spotlight: Essential Extracts for Acne-Prone Skin

Dealing with blemishes can be a frustrating challenge , but certain essential oils may offer relief. Melaleuca oil is a well-known choice due to its germ-fighting properties, helping to reduce bacteria that contribute to spots . Lavender oil can calm red skin and encourage recovery , while clary sage oil is thought to assist with hormone regulation , a common factor in some breakout cases. Be sure to dilute these powerful oils with a base oil like jojoba oil before applying to the face and perform a small test area first to ensure for any sensitivities when using regularly.
